WebConcessionary fares for people with a disability Free travel pass. If you have moderate or severe learning disabilities or certain other severe physical difficulties/sensory impairment, you can apply for a free travel pass for buses, trains and trams within Greater Manchester, and travel at approximately half the full fare to neighbouring counties. WebOutside of the times listed above, the full adult fare is payable for all Concessionary Travel Pass holders. If you are a disabled customer with a Travel Pass and you travel before 9:30am on weekdays, you will be required to pay the normal concessionary (half price) fare in Greater Manchester and the full adult fare outside of Greater Manchester. fisherman\\u0027s bike neuhemsbach
